Duration: 3–4 Hours Admission: Included The Experience: Contrast the dry Maasai plains with a hidden tropical oasis. Chemka is a natural phenomenon—geothermal water that bubbles up into a crystal-clear, turquoise lagoon surrounded by massive, ancient fig trees. The "Blue Lagoon": Swim in warm, mineral-rich water that is so clear you can see the bottom 10 meters down. The Rope Swing: For the adventurous, use the "Tarzan" rope swing to leap into the deepest parts of the spring. Natural Fish Spa: If you sit still at the edge, tiny Garra Rufa fish will gently nibble your feet for a natural pedicure! Wildlife Spotting: Keep an eye out for blue monkeys playing in the canopy above and colorful kingfishers diving for a snack.
